Christian Völker wrote:
> Makes sense to me. Is there any FS which would be recommended for best
> performance?

OpenSolaris + ZFS.  For best performance, 2G of RAM and a dual-core CPU 
would be minimum requirements IMO.

No doubt people will complain about such heavy requirements.  I would 
respond that you can build such a machine for under $200 (AMD).
